桐柏—大别山高压超高压变质带自南向北可划分为3个带:绿帘-蓝片岩相变质带,高压榴辉岩相变质和超高压榴辉岩相变质带,超高压变质带形成于加里东期洋壳俯冲作用过程中,而前两个高压变质带则是印支期陆-陆俯冲-碰撞作用的产物。  相似文献

The kinetics of the reaction of NO2 with O3 have been investigated at 296 K, using UV absorption spectroscopy to monitor decay of NO2 or O3 and infrared laser absorption spectroscopy to monitor formation of the reaction product N2O5. The results both for the rate coefficient at 296 K (k 1=3.5×10-17 cm3 molecule-1 s-1) and the reaction stoichiometry (NO2/O3=1.85±0.09) are in good agreement with previous studies, confirming that the two step mechanism involving formation of symmetrical NO3 as an intermediate is predominant.% MathType!MTEF!2!1!+-% feaafiart1ev1aaatCvAUfeBSjuyZL2yd9gzLbvyNv2CaerbuLwBLn% hiov2DGi1BTfMBaeXatLxBI9gBaerbd9wDYLwzYbItLDharqqtubsr% 4rNCHbGeaGqiVu0Je9sqqrpepC0xbbL8F4rqqrFfpeea0xe9Lq-Jc9% vqaqpepm0xbba9pwe9Q8fs0-yqaqpepae9pg0FirpepeKkFr0xfr-x% fr-xb9adbaqaaeGaciGaaiaabeqaamaabaabaaGcbaGaaeOtaiaab+% eadaWgaaWcbaGaaeOmaaqabaGccqGHRaWkcaqGpbWaaSbaaSqaaiaa% bodaaeqaaOWaa4ajaSqaaaqabOGaayPKHaGaaeOtaiaab+eadaWgaa% WcbaGaae4maaqabaGccqGHRaWkcaqGpbWaaSbaaSqaaiaabkdaaeqa% aaaa!41D7!\[{\text{NO}}_{\text{2}} + {\text{O}}_{\text{3}} \xrightarrow{{}}{\text{NO}}_{\text{3}} + {\text{O}}_{\text{2}} \]% MathType!MTEF!2!1!+-% feaafiart1ev1aaatCvAUfeBSjuyZL2yd9gzLbvyNv2CaerbuLwBLn% hiov2DGi1BTfMBaeXatLxBI9gBaerbd9wDYLwzYbItLDharqqtubsr% 4rNCHbGeaGqiVu0Je9sqqrpepC0xbbL8F4rqqrFfpeea0xe9Lq-Jc9% vqaqpepm0xbba9pwe9Q8fs0-yqaqpepae9pg0FirpepeKkFr0xfr-x% fr-xb9adbaqaaeGaciGaaiaabeqaamaabaabaaGcbaGaaeOtaiaab+% eadaWgaaWcbaGaae4maaqabaGccqGHRaWkcaqGobGaae4tamaaBaaa% leaacaqGYaaabeaakiabgUcaRiaab2eadaGdKaWcbaaabeGccaGLsg% cacaqGobWaaSbaaSqaaiaabkdaaeqaaOGaae4tamaaBaaaleaacaqG% 1aaabeaakiabgUcaRiaab2eaaaa!4464!\[{\text{NO}}_{\text{3}} + {\text{NO}}_{\text{2}} + {\text{M}}\xrightarrow{{}}{\text{N}}_{\text{2}} {\text{O}}_{\text{5}} + {\text{M}}\]A possible minor role for the unsymmetrical ONOO species is suggested to account for the lower-than-expected stoichiometry factor. The importance of this reaction in the oxidation of atmospheric NO2 is discussed.  相似文献

Water-soluble dicarboxylic acids (DCAs), ketoacids, and α-dicarbonyls in the marine aerosol samples collected over the Southern Ocean and western Pacific Ocean were determined. Oxalic acid was the most abundant species, followed by malonic acid and then succinic acid. It is suggested that aerosol concentrations of the organics over the Southern Ocean in this work represent their global background levels. Over the Southern Ocean, total concentrations of DCAs ranged from 2.9 to 7.2 ng m−3 (average: 4.5 ng m−3), ketoacids from 0.14 to 0.40 ng m−3 (av.: 0.28 ng m−3), and dicarbonyls from 0.06 to 0.29 ng m−3 (av.: 0.11 ng m−3). Over the western Pacific, total concentrations of DCAs ranged from 1.7 to 170 ng m−3 (av.: 60 ng m−3), ketoacids from 0.08 to 5.3 ng m−3 (av.: 1.8 ng m−3), and dicarbonyls from 0.03 to 4.6 ng m−3 (av.: 0.95 ng m−3). DCAs over the western Pacific have constituted a large fraction of organic aerosols with a mean DCAs-C/TC (total carbon) of 7.0% (range: 0.59–14%). Such a high value was in contrast to the low DCAs-C/TC (av.: 1.8%; range: 0.89–4.0%) for the Southern Ocean aerosols. Based on the relative abundances and latitudinal distributions of these organics, we propose that long-range atmospheric transport is more important over the western Pacific Ocean, in contrast, in situ photochemical production is more significant over the Southern Ocean although absolute concentrations of the organics are much lower.  相似文献

The Ogcheon metamorphic belt in central Korea has been interpreted to be the eastward extension of the Nanhua Basin (aulacogen) of southeast China. In this paper, comparisons are made between the two regions based on stratigraphic, thermal-tectonic and other considerations. From this comparison, correlation of geological events between the Nanhua Basin and Ogcheon metamorphic belt are at best equivocal. The closest similarity is the presence in both regions of two major diamictite units, of glacial origin and Neoproterozoic age (750–690 Ma range) in China but of controversial origin and uncertain age in Korea. Volcanic rocks in both regions appear to have similar petrological and geochemical traits and are interpreted to be rift-related. However, their ages are different, mostly 795–780 Ma in the Nanhua Basin and c. 750 Ma in central Korea, so correlation remains uncertain. More isotopic data from both regions may shed light on this comparison. Correlation between other pre-Carboniferous stratigraphic units in the two regions is hampered by the uncertainty about the stratigraphic age and succession in the Ogcheon metamorphic belt, stemming mainly from the absence of fossils and the strong tectonic–metamorphic overprint. Both regions appear to have undergone deformation and metamorphism during the Middle Triassic (Indosinian, Songrim), in some uncertain way related to the collision between the North and South China plates. In the Ogcheon metamorphic belt, there has been no confirmation of a Mid Palaeozoic event, but in the Nanhua Basin that event is recorded by stratigraphic and palaeogeographic evidence. In the Nanhua Basin, there is no evidence for an Early Permian metamorphic event that appears, on isotopic grounds, to have affected the Ogcheon metamorphic belt. This apparent difference has been interpreted as a result of diachronous deformation during Late Palaeozoic–Early Mesozoic plate collisions that took place earlier in the east, in Korea, than in the west in China.  相似文献

中国大陆科学钻探工程主孔深5158m,位于苏鲁超高压变质带南部。该钻孔钻进了一个超高压变质岩片,其主要榴辉岩、片麻岩、超基性岩和少量石英和片岩组成。基于连续样品的详细氧同位素分析可得出下列认识:(1)各种变质矿物的氧同位素成分具有很大的变化,其中石榴石为-7.4~+6.2‰,绿辉石为-5.2~+6.5‰。白云母为-4.4- +7.1‰,斜长石为-3.1~+7.6‰,钾长石为4.8~8.3‰,石英为-2.8- +9.6‰。(2)整个钻孔剖面的氧同位素成分是连续和逐渐的变化的,而且与岩石类型无关,氧同位素亏损岩石产出的最大深度为3320m。这个深度之下的岩石均具有正常变质岩的氧同位素值。(3)氧同位素明显亏损的变质岩大多出现在正、副片麻岩及其与榴辉岩的互层带。(4)榴辉岩矿物大多具有平衡的氧同位素分异,大多数高压和低压石英脉体具有与它们的围岩类似的氧同位素成分。(5)利用石英.石榴石氧同位素温度计,所获得的榴辉岩变质温度为598~909℃,片麻岩的变质温度为550~786℃。基于这些事实,并结合氧同位素亏损变质岩在地表和浅钻孔中的广泛分布,可以得出以下重要结论:(1)在苏鲁造山带,有大量的表壳岩石与巨量的寒冷气候下的大气降水发生过交换作用,这为新元古代全球冰期的存在提供了重要证据。(2)许多呈厚层产出的花岗质片麻岩具有正常变质岩的氧同位素成分,并缺少超高压变质作用证据。(3)在大陆深俯冲和折返过程中,只存在通道式的水-岩相作用和非常有限的流体活动,与高压退变质有关的流体是原地形成的。(4)新元古代Rodinia超大陆裂解环境下形成的双峰式岩浆活动为大气降水与表壳岩之间的热液蚀变提供了热源。  相似文献

苏鲁-大别超高压变质岩的弹性力学性质与密度的关系   总被引:4,自引:1,他引:4  
我们采集了31块来自中国大陆科学钻探(CCSD)主孔和预先导孔岩芯以及29块苏鲁-大别地区地表露头的典型超高压变质岩,在10~850 MPa的静水压力和室温下测量了60块标本的P波与S波速度,分别建立了纵横波速和围压之间的定量关系,并在此基础上计算了不同压力下各岩石标本的弹性参数即杨氏模量(E)、剪切模量(G)、体模量(K)和泊松比(v),着重探讨了超高压变质岩的弹性力学性质与密度之间的关系.这些最新成果将为超高压变质岩地区以及新老俯冲带地震波资料的解释提供关键的理论和实验基础.  相似文献

对中国大陆科学钻探孔区——江苏省东海县毛北地区的55块榴辉岩样品进行了古地磁研究,并从中抽样测试了等温剩磁、磁滞迴线、磁组构、热磁化率以及电子探针和镜下分析,结果表明,毛北榴辉岩有两组稳定的剩磁,即反向磁化和正向磁化,稳定剩磁方向分别为:D=94.3°,I=-29.1°和D=273.7°,I=15.4°,携带正向磁化与携带反向磁化样品的磁化强度和密度变化很大;毛北榴辉岩的磁各向异性度非常弱,最小轴方向很难确定;等温剩磁和磁滞迴线显示磁铁矿可能是毛北榴辉岩的主要载磁矿物,且在以Mr/Ms和Hcr/Hc的对数为纵、横坐标的图上落在视单畴(PSD)区域.根据磁性特征,对毛北榴辉岩的磁性载体成因、剩磁获得机制及构造意义进行了讨论.  相似文献

文章论述了安徽歙县浅变质岩系微古植物化石的产出特点(计有27属40种)和它的时代意义,分析研究了西村组和昌溪组的优势属,分别为Leiominuscula,Leiofusa,Asperatopsophos-phaera,Germinosphaera,Melanocyillum和Germinosphaera,Leiominuscula,Leiopsophosphaera,Triangumorpha,Leiofusa等各5属。通过对比论证,提出西村组、昌溪组形成的地质时代应为中元古代蓟县纪。  相似文献

通过对内蒙古大青山—乌拉山地区高级变质杂岩的研究发现,区内孔兹岩系先后遭受到近水平顺层滑脱变形、穹-褶构造和近东西向陡倾叶理带的改造。由于近水平顺层滑脱变形,这些变质地层发生“岩层缺失、隔层相触”,在空间上表现为近水平的长轴近东西向的扁豆体堆叠而成的变质地层结构,而后期近东西向陡倾叶理带的叠加,又使得这些变质地层在空间上以不规则条带状、不规则团块状或透镜状形式出露,各变质地层单位之间及与其他变质岩系之间显现出“犬牙交错、参差产出”的特征,从而显示出十分复杂的变质地层结构。可以确定,区内孔兹岩系至少经历了2个造山旋回,近水平顺层滑脱变形构造及对应的变质地层结构是早期造山旋回后期阶段的产物,而近东西向陡倾叶理带及相应的变质地层结构则属于后期造山旋回。  相似文献

This part of work is aimed at consideration of problems concerning evolution of geodynamic processes based on characteristic structures of the Early Precambrian and their rocks. Considered in the paper are structures characterizing existence of mature continental crust (sedimentary basins), development of the crust (metamorphic belts and granitoids) and underlying upper mantle (lithospheric keel), and amalgamation of crustal domains (continents, microcontinents, terrains) into supercontinents. Geodynamic phenomena of the Early Precambrian comparable with the Phanerozoic ones are distinguishable, on the one hand, and their changes with time of evolutionary character are detectable, on the other. The latter are satisfactorily explainable by secular lowering of the mantle temperature in general and above the top of mantle plumes.  相似文献
